A beautifully presented penthouse with a large balcony and secure underground parking.

Description

23 Cestria Quayside forms part of a secure development constructed by Watkin Jones. The current owners bought direct from the developer in 2018 and use the property as a second home. The vendors were attracted by the security of the building including gated underground parking and have found the property to be the perfect lock up and leave.

Entry into the apartment is via a spacious hallway which has a cloaks cupboard and access through to the superb open-plan living space. The kitchen/sitting/dining room is a really bright and airy space with a vaulted ceiling to the dining area and floor to ceiling picture window which creates a real wow factor and encapsulates the lovely view.

The kitchen has an extensive range of fitted wall and base units, granite work surfaces and high quality Neff integrated appliances to include dishwasher, fridge freezer, microwave, double oven, wine cooler and breakfast bar.

Beyond the kitchen is the seating area with access via French doors out to the balcony. The balcony is really spacious with plenty of room for outdoor furniture and plants, it truly is an extension of the entertaining space. There are far-reaching views of the river to both sides.

There is a principal bedroom suite with en suite bathroom and access via French doors out to the balcony. A guest bedroom (currently laid out as a study) and a family bathroom completes the accommodation.

The property is fitted throughout with amtico flooring and the apartment is beautifully decorated in a stylish, neutral colour palette. The apartment is on the fourth floor and has lift access. There is an intercom with video at the main entrance linking to the property. The secure, gated car park is under cover and accessed via electric gates.

Location

Cestria is situated a short distance from the city centre. All the amenities that the city has to offer including excellent shops and fine dining are within walking distance.

The Cathedral City of Chester is one of the north-west's leading retail and commercial centres and offers an extensive range of shops, restaurants and cultural activities.

Chester has direct access to the motorway network, linking to Manchester, Liverpool and their airports and to the North Wales coast. There is a direct and regular rail service to London Euston (about 2 hours).

Chester is the home of one of the oldest racecourses in the country and it provides an extensive programme of horse racing and other events including polo. Grosvenor Park, during the summer months, hosts a programme of open air theatre and outdoor cinema.

Cestria Quayside is in close proximity to the racecourse and there is a footpath/cycleway beneath the building which meanders along the riverbank, past the racecourse and into the city. Heading in the other direction it leads all the way to North Wales. There is also access into the city along the canal tow path which is directly across from the building and is a very pleasant and quick walk past the city walls and into Northgate Street.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
